Transaction d2c250aab303e4f042d15ee5ff6fa2ca14526d024685841d668c6fef76aa44ed
1 Input
1 Output
-
d2c250aab303e4f042d15ee5ff6fa2ca14526d024685841d668c6fef76aa44ed:0
- value
- 295740991
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 39cfc51d20718924987d290a17f6fa346ac976d295a443a2ac6ca43086b84da5
- address
- bc1p888u28fqwxyjfxra9y9p0ah6x34vjakjjkjy8g4vdjjrpp4cfkjsvs68wx